v2/docs/reasoningbank/CLAUDE-CODE-INTEGRATION.md
This guide shows how to integrate ReasoningBank's self-learning memory system into Claude Code's hook lifecycle, enabling automatic pattern learning, retrieval, and confidence updates.
┌─────────────────────────────────────────────────────────┐
│ Claude Code Hook Lifecycle │
├─────────────────────────────────────────────────────────┤
│ │
│ PreToolUse (Before Operations) │
│ ├─ Query ReasoningBank for relevant patterns │
│ ├─ Inject context into operation │
│ └─ Load confidence scores │
│ │
│ PostToolUse (After Operations) │
│ ├─ Store new patterns from successful operations │
│ ├─ Update confidence based on outcomes │
│ └─ Track usage statistics │
│ │
│ Stop (Session End) │
│ ├─ Consolidate memories │
│ ├─ Remove duplicates │
│ └─ Export session learnings │
│ │
└─────────────────────────────────────────────────────────┘

# Store a pattern
npx claude-flow@alpha memory store <key> <value> \
--namespace <namespace> \
--reasoningbank \
--confidence 0.5
# Store with metadata
npx claude-flow@alpha memory store bug_fix_123 \
"Fixed CORS by adding middleware" \
--namespace debugging \
--reasoningbank \
--confidence 0.6 \
--metadata '{"file": "server.js", "line": 45}'
# Query semantically
npx claude-flow@alpha memory query "authentication patterns" \
--reasoningbank \
--limit 3 \
--format json
# Query with filters
npx claude-flow@alpha memory query "bug fixes" \
--namespace debugging \
--reasoningbank \
--min-confidence 0.7
# List all patterns
npx claude-flow@alpha memory list --reasoningbank
# List by namespace
npx claude-flow@alpha memory list \
--namespace commands \
--reasoningbank \
--limit 10
# Consolidate memories (remove duplicates, prune low-confidence)
npx claude-flow@alpha memory consolidate \
--reasoningbank \
--threshold 0.9 \
--prune-low-confidence 0.2
# Consolidate specific namespace
npx claude-flow@alpha memory consolidate \
--namespace debugging \
--reasoningbank
# Get ReasoningBank statistics
npx claude-flow@alpha memory stats --reasoningbank
1. PreToolUse Hook (Write tool)
├─ Extract: file_path = "src/api/server.js"
├─ Query: npx claude-flow memory query "server.js api patterns"
├─ Result: Found 2 patterns with 85% confidence
└─ Inject: Context added to operation
2. User Edit Operation
├─ Claude Code applies the edit
└─ Result: Success (no errors)
3. PostToolUse Hook (Write tool)
├─ Extract: file_path, exit_code = 0
├─ Store: npx claude-flow memory store "edit_server_1729123456"
├─ Pattern: "Successfully edited server.js API endpoint"
└─ Initial confidence: 0.5
4. Future Query (Same File)
├─ Query: "server.js patterns"
├─ Retrieve: Previous pattern with updated confidence
└─ Confidence: 0.5 → 0.6 (after successful reuse)
Recommended namespace structure:
commands/ # Bash command patterns
code/ # Code editing patterns
debugging/ # Bug fixes and solutions
api/ # API design patterns
database/ # Database query patterns
security/ # Security best practices
performance/ # Performance optimizations
testing/ # Test patterns
deployment/ # Deployment procedures
session/ # Current session patterns

Create .claude/hooks/reasoningbank-pre.sh:
#!/bin/bash
# Custom ReasoningBank pre-hook
FILE="$1"
NAMESPACE="${2:-code}"
# Extract file context
EXT="${FILE##*.}"
FILENAME=$(basename "$FILE")
# Query relevant patterns
PATTERNS=$(npx claude-flow@alpha memory query \
"$EXT $FILENAME" \
--namespace "$NAMESPACE" \
--reasoningbank \
--limit 5 \
--format json 2>/dev/null)
# Format output
if echo "$PATTERNS" | jq -e '.results | length > 0' > /dev/null 2>&1; then
echo "📚 Found $(echo "$PATTERNS" | jq '.results | length') relevant patterns"
echo "$PATTERNS" | jq -r '.results[] | " • \(.key): \(.confidence * 100 | round)%"'
else
echo "📝 No patterns yet - this will be a learning opportunity"
fi
Usage in .claude/settings.json:
{
"type": "command",
"command": "cat | jq -r '.tool_input.file_path' | xargs -I {} .claude/hooks/reasoningbank-pre.sh {}"
}
